9 Bridge Piece, Birmingham, B31 3XF is a leasehold flat built between 1976-1982. The property offers approximately 409 square feet of living space.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£70,705 , which equates to approximately £173 per square foot. It was last sold on 21 Mar 2025 for £72,000. Since then, the value has decreased by £1,295, representing a 1.8% decrease, or approximately 2.4% per year.

The current estimated value of £70,705 is:

  • 43.1% lower than the average property price on Bridge Piece
  • 40.2% lower than the average in the B31 3XF postcode area
  • and 74.2% lower than the average price for Birmingham as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 18 October 2021, the property was recorded as rented.

EPC Summary

9 Bridge Piece, Birmingham, West Midlands, B31 3XF has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 18 Oct 2021.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 2 Nov 2011.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 21.4%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from room heaters, electric to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from poor to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from electric immersion, off-peak to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from poor to good.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in 50%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to good.
